Output 3edddb74e06af71ee27e741b165a11aecf2f3c6e1a3ad1cdcb46b3d4d295a0bb:1

value
69921794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e04816bed014a49c0486e8a92baec4d2464b1c8 OP_EQUAL
address
38oY2ZJqHZ1EKqfxDVaGLuE484Z2fRMmbc
transaction
3edddb74e06af71ee27e741b165a11aecf2f3c6e1a3ad1cdcb46b3d4d295a0bb
confirmations
211450
spent
true